What You'll Do

The Senior Project Manager is responsible for planning, directing, and coordinating commercial and industrial construction projects to ensure goals and objectives are achieved within established timelines and budget parameters. This role also plays a key part in strengthening existing client relationships and developing new, long-term partnerships with clients and subcontractors.

Key Responsibilities
  • Upon project assignment, develop and refine project specific and client-driven goals, schedules, and budgets.
  • Assist the design team during the design phase on negotiated design-build projects by identifying inefficiencies and recommending solutions to maintain budget while meeting project requirements.
  • Coordinate due diligence efforts on behalf of the client, ensuring all required documentation is maintained and delivered.
  • Establish and maintain project goals and success criteria that align with client needs.
  • Develop and maintain project budget, schedules, and cost control. Actively track each aspect of project performance against schedules and critical path.
  • Complete monthly project health reports and meet with management team to discuss cost and any issues on the projects.
  • Coordinate with the Construction Technology Leader to support VDC implementation.
  • Provide estimating assistance to preconstruction staff as needed.
  • Track and communicate weekly project schedule updates to subcontractors and owners.
  • Prepare and execute subcontracts and purchase orders. Monitor and approve vendor and subcontractor invoices. Develop and process monthly pay applications.
  • Submit and review change orders while effectively communicating issues and developing resolutions.
  • Lead weekly project meetings with all stakeholders.
  • Review and address plan details, resolving issues proactively to prevent additional budget expenditures.
  • Maintain continual open communication with clients, design team, Project Superintendents, subcontractors, and vendors.
  • Proactively identify project risks and develop mitigation strategies to ensure successful project delivery.
  • Serve as the primary point of accountability for overall project success, including client satisfaction, financial performance, and team leadership.
  • Provide leadership, coaching, and mentoring of less experienced Project Managers and Assistant Project Managers.
  • Manage and supervise Project Engineers and Senior Project Engineers as required.
  • Attend client interviews and meetings.
  • Contribute to the development of standard operating procedures for the Operations Team.
  • Perform additional assignments at supervisor's direction.
Supervisory Responsibility:
  • This position directly supervises Project Engineers and Senior Project Engineers assigned to work on projects under their supervision. This position also supports, mentors, and trains less experienced employees to enhance their value in the organization.
Travel Requirements:
  • Occasional travel to meetings or events within 75-mile radius of office, 1 - 2 times per week
  • Occasional travel to various project locations requiring an overnight stay, 20-25 times per year
What We're Looking For

Education & Experience:
  • Bachelor's degree in construction management, Civil Engineering, or related field
  • Minimum of 10 years of project management experience in a commercial and/or industrial construction environment.
  • Experience managing mid-to-large commercial and industrial construction projects typically $30M+ in value.
